= LZTestKit
 
This package extends lzunit with behavioral testing, asynchronous
test support, test case selection, and automated test sequencing.
 
* <b>Test case selection</b> runs a single test case within a test
  applet, without modifying the sources. (You supply the name of the
  test case as a query parameter in the application URL.) It allows
  you to use your test applet as your debugging scaffolding, without
  running a lot of code that you aren't interested in.
 
* <b>Automated test sequencing</b> runs all the test applets in a
  directory, in series, in a single browser window, stopping if one of
  them has an error. It allows you to run all of a package's test
  cases from the browser by visiting a single url, instead of
  navigating to each url in turn.
 
* <b>Behavioral testing</b> implements mocks, stubs, and expectations.
  It allows you to *test* one class, while *stubbing* the classes that
  it depends on. You can even verify that the tested class makes
  functions thatyou expect it to. This is a loose port of rspec to
  OpenLaszlo.
 
* <b>Asynchronous test support</b> allows you to write a test case
  that is only considered complete when the callback functions or
  delegates that it defines return. If a test case creates a callback
  function, the test case is only complete when the callback function
  returns. (Except if the callback function creates a callback
  function, etc.)
 
== Requirements
 
This package requires OpenLaszlo 3.4.0 or 4.0.6. (Other versions
might work, but aren't tested.)
 
== Installation
 
* Download the latest version from {download-location}.
 
* Unpack it into your OpenLaszlo webapp directory; for example, at
  <tt>${OPENLASZLO_HOME}/Server/lps-3.4.0/lztestkit</tt>.
 
* Visit e.g. http://127.0.0.1:8080/openlaszlo-4.0.6/lztestkit/examples
  and http://127.0.0.1:8080/openlaszlo-4.0.6/lztestkit/test. (The
  first part of the path will be different if you've got a different
  version of OpenLaszlo, or if you've installed the servlet instead of
  the server). You should be able to click on the examples and tests
  in order to run them.
 
== Features
 
=== Test case selection
 
If a test application is compiled with support for test case selection, you
can invoke it with a <tt>testCase=<em>{testCaseName}</em></tt> query parameter
to run only the test case named <em>{testCaseName}</em>.
 
Include <tt>lzunit-extensions.js</tt> in your application (or include
<tt>library.lzx</tt>, which includes this). Then, include the
testCase={testCaseName} query parameter in the URL that you use to
open the application, where {testCaseName} is the name of the test
case. Only this test case will execute.
 
See the example in <tt>examples/test-selection.lzx</tt>.
 
=== Automated test sequencing
 
Copy <tt>test/autorun/index.jsp</tt> into your test directory to run
all the test applications in that directory within a single browser
window, without user interaction.
 
Copy <tt>test/autorun/index.jsp</tt> into your test directory, and
update the includes at the top of the file to reflect the paths to the
lztestkit <tt>src</tt> and <tt>lib</tt> subdirectories. By default,
this file will run files in its directory that match /test-*.lzx/;
this is a configuration parameter that it should be obvious how to
change.
 
Each test cases should include <tt>autorun-lz.js</tt> via <script
src="autorun-lz.js"/>. If you have a <tt>library.lzx</tt> file with
test scaffolding, you can place that directive there.
 
==== Support files
<tt>autorun-lz.js</tt>:: implements the OpenLaszlo side of automated execution
<tt>autorun-browser.js</tt>:: implements browser support
<tt>autorun-include.jsp</tt>:: is a JSP include that embeds the files in the current directory into the generated HTML for the index page
<tt>jquery-1.2.1.min.js</tt>:: is the jQuery library. I didn't write this! but the browser support file needs it
<tt>swfobject.js</tt>:: is the swfobject library. I didn't write this! but the browser support file needs it
 
 
=== Behavioral testing
 
TODO
 
This lets you write things like this in a test case:
 
  myMockObject = Mock.Create(MyClass);
  myMockObject.mock.expects.aMethod(1, 'arg', {name:2});
  // call a fn that invokes myMockObject.aMethod(1, 'arg', {name:2})
  myMockObject.mock.verify();
 
  myMockObject.stub('aMethod', 'arg1', 'arg2', Function)
    .by.calling(1);
  // call a fn that invokes myMockObject.aMethod('arg1', 'arg2', function(n) {...})
  // and expects the funarg to be called back with n=1
 
  calling(anObject, 'methodName', 'arg1')
    .should.call(otherObject, 'method', 'some', 'arguments')
    .and.send(anObject, 'onchange', 'data')
    .and.returnWith(1)
 
  constructing('MyClass', 'initarg')
    .should.call(otherObject, 'method', 'some', 'arguments')

=== Asynchronous test support
 
TODO
 
This features allows lzunit to run asynchronous tests, which are not
complete until a delegate or callback has been called. A typical
usage pattern is the following test, which asserts that setTimeout
delays at least the requested amount of time:
 
  <method name="testSetTimeout" args="c">
    var interval = 1000,
        startTime = new Date;
    // c(function(){...}) is equivalent to function(){...}
    // except that it re-enters the dynamic bindings of the
    // test case.
    setTimeout(c(function() {
      var endTime = new Date;
      assertTrue(endTime - startTime >= interval);
    }), interval);
  </method>
 
For now, see <tt>examples/test-lzunit-async.lzx</tt>. The new methods are
also copiously documented in <tt>src/lzunit-async.lzx</tt>.
